NES Fircroft are happy to be working with a manufacturing company in Hartlepool. They are looking for Forklift Drivers to support their busy and ever-expanding warehouse operations, covering weekend shifts. Initial work into 2027 though may have the chance to become a permanent / long-term opportunity.

Overview:

  • Other than the first few weeks of Mon-Fri shifts whilst training, this will then become Weekend working only.
  • Will be 3 x 12hr day shifts every weekend.
  • Can either be Fri-Sat-Sun or Sat-Sun-Mon working 36 hours per week.

Requirements:

  • Candidate must have valid counterbalance forklift licence to apply (preferably RTITB though others may be accepted).
  • Proven previous experience driving FLT's in a similar warehouse / manufacturing type environment is desired.
  • Initial few weeks will be Mon-Fri for mandatory training before moving into weekend work.
